| 
  • If you are citizen of an European Union member nation, you may not use this service unless you are at least 16 years old.

  • Stop wasting time looking for files and revisions. Connect your Gmail, DriveDropbox, and Slack accounts and in less than 2 minutes, Dokkio will automatically organize all your file attachments. Learn more and claim your free account.

View
 

Lynnedu-ES

Page history last edited by macagua 9 years, 8 months ago

http://www.lynn.edu/

 

 

Notas acerca el dibujo anterior

  • Cada cosa dentro del cajón azul esta virtualizada en VMware, excepto el mecanismo de almacenamiento (storage). 
  • Todos los servidores son Servidores Windows 2003.
  • Yo no creo pienso que el almacenamiento se monta a través de NFS.
  • Este dibujo es ligeramente actualizada de un original suministrado por Cignix, con los que consultó antes de nuestro lanzamiento del sitio en octubre de 2008. 
  • Solamente Zope Instancia 2 y Zope Instancia 3 son aparte del balanceador de carga.

 

Notas acerca de esta instalción

  • La razón para que el proxy este fuera de las instalaciones, es por conmutación por error de emergencia. Nosotros estamos ubicados en el sur de la Florida, amenazada por huracanes, entre otras cosas. Si pierde el campus de Internet, electricidad, o nos golpeó con el tráfico, queremos ser capaces de tener un sitio de bajo ancho de banda en un servidor distante proporcionar información importante sin tener que esperar para la propagación de DNS.
  • Nosotros nos fuimos con una configuración de instalación virtualizada sobre todo en la recomendación de nuestros departamento de TIC que esta encargado de la migración de muchos servicios a VMware. Estábamos bajo una presión de tiempo, y esto era mucho más rápido que la adquisición de hardware.

 

Antecedentes sobre el proyecto 

Somos un pequeño equipo de 3 diseñadores web / desarrolladores más un miembro principal del personal de soporte en departamento de TIC de la universidad. Ninguno de nosotros tenía conocimiento previo de Plone, Zope y Python. La primera vez que oí hablar de Plone / Zope fue marzo de 2008. El 08 de junio ya se estaban desarrollando los tipos de contenido personalizados con la ayuda de Cignix y lo pusimos en marcha e 08 de octubre. Por supuesto, creo que todavía estamos en la base de la curva de aprendizaje de Plone.

 

Rendimiento

En los 13 meses desde que nosotros publicamos el sitio Web, nosotros hemos tenido algunos problemas de rendimiento, pero me inclino a creer que se debe a nuestra falta de conocimiento de Zope y Plone, en lugar de la virtualización.

  • Nosotros tenemos dos instancias Zope en el balanceador de carga que se reiniciar automáticamente dos veces por semana debido a Python uso de memoria RAM.
  • Sólo recientemente habilitado CacheFu y parece que ha marcado bien, pero estoy seguro de que hay margen de mejora.
  • También recientemente aumentamos el tamaño de caché en los clientes de Zope a 10.000. 

A pesar de algunos contratiempos, esta ha sido la configuración relativamente estable para nosotros, aunque a menudo nos preguntamos si se notaria una ganancia de rendimiento en un entorno no virtualizado.

De vez en cuando tenemos un problema por el que uno, luego el otro, de los clientes Zope del balanceador de carga dejará de responder a las peticiones web, pero cuando nos fijamos en la memoria RAM / uso de la CPU y el registro en el servidor, todo parece estar bien. Por lo general, la CPU es elevado, pero no vinculado. Ninguno-el-menos, tenemos que matar el proceso y empezar de nuevo. Estos problemas parecen venir en ráfagas. Vamos semanas sin problemas, a continuación, han producido algunos incidentes en el transcurso de una semana o dos.

 

Especificaciones de Servidor Virtual para Plone

LynnWebZeo:

Server - VMware

CPU - 4 x 2.3GHz Intel Xeon

RAM - 1536MB

Storage - RAID5/Fiber Drives/iSCSI

LynnWebZope1:

Server - VMware

CPU - 4 x 2.3GHz Intel Xeon

RAM - 2048MB

Storage - RAID5/SATA Drives/CIFS Share

LynnWebZope2:

Server - VMware

CPU - 4 x 2.3GHz Intel Xeon

RAM - 2048MB

Storage - RAID5/SATA Drives/CIFS Share

LynnWebZope3:

Server - VMware

CPU - 4 x 2.3GHz Intel Xeon

RAM - 2048MB

Storage - RAID5/SATA Drives/CIFS Share

 

Especificaciones fisicas del Servidor 

Los servidores son HP ProLiant G5, cada uno con Quad Core Intel Xeon 2.33GHz y 20GB RAM

 

Especificaciones de VMware

VMware ESX 3.5 con VMware Virtual Center 2.5

 

Especificaciones de Plone

Actualmente: Plone 3.3.1, Zope 2.10.9

 

LynnWebZope2:

cache-size: 20,000

zserver-threads: 4

LynnWebZope3:

cache-size: 20,000

zserver-threads: 4

Comments (0)

You don't have permission to comment on this page.